I have an HP JetDirect 300X printer server and an HP 970Cse printer (I am running 10.2.1). The USB driver works just fine... however, I need to connect to the JetDirect.

* I've enabled AppleTalk but the JetDirect is nowhere to be found

* I figure I want to add a new IP Printer via the Print Center - but since my printer driver is not in the default list I need to browse for my desired printer driver. Unfortunately, HP's inkjet installer does not appear to install any selectable driver files.

Anyone have any success with a JetDirect regardless of printer type?

You should be able to drive the printer via jet direct using cups and gimp print. Before you start, you should download the gimp print driver package from http://gimp-print.sourceforge.net/MacOSX.php3
Install the package and proceed. Go to your browser and enter http://127.0.0.1:631/ Click administration, Click add printer, Enter a name (location and desc. are optional) and click continue, select appsocket/hp jetdirect from the dropdown and click continue, now enter the ip of your jet direct (ex: socket://x.x.x.x:9100) with the x.x.x.x being your ip and the 9100 is the default port on jetdirect so you should be fine with leaving it "as is". So finish entering your socket info and click continue, select hp from the list box and click continue, select your model from the list box and click continue and your printer is added, you can fine tune your settings from the admin page, when you install it in cups, it is automatically installed in the print center. Oh and make sure tcp/ip is enabled on your jet direct. You don't need appletalk using this method.
